About the Role:

Connectors are at the heart of every Tray interface so ensuring that connectors meet the standard that our customers expect is crucial to the success of Tray as a company. As a Technical Product Manager at Tray.io, you will play a crucial role in driving the success of our platform by managing our connector universe and assisting the development of our public API. 

You will be working closely with our Customer Success and Engineering teams to ensure that the process for prioritising bugs, extending our connector library and API deprecations is smooth and efficient. You will also play a key role in the development of our public API which is a key component of the Tray code interface. 

This is an exciting opportunity to both shape the future of our product and ensure that quality and efficiency are at the forefront of everything we do. 

Responsibilities:

  • Collaborate with project management teams to define project plans, allocate resources, and manage timelines for connector development. 
  • Develop and implement a strategy to handle API deprecations, ensuring smooth transitions for customers and minimising disruption.
  • Establish and manage a process for effectively tracking, prioritising, and resolving bugs reported by customers or discovered internally. 
  • Assist the development of our Public API by ensuring that our API is best in class when it comes to developer experience and ease of use. 
  • Work closely with our documentation team to enrich our developer portal, making it both an excellent developer resource but also a powerful marketing tool.
  • Gather feedback from customers, sales, and customer success teams to identify areas for improvement and define requirements for connector enhancements and new feature development.
  • Conduct research and competitive analysis to stay updated on industry trends and identify opportunities for innovation in the connector space.
  • Collaborate with marketing and sales teams to develop effective messaging and positioning for our connectors, enabling them to drive adoption and revenue growth.

Requirement:

  • Strong technical background with a solid understanding of APIs, web technologies, and software development processes.
  • Experience with building products and features that demonstrably solve a problem for an end user. 
  • Previous project management skills, with the ability to manage multiple projects, prioritise effectively, and meet deadlines.
  • Excellent communication skills, with the ability to effectively collaborate with cross-functional teams and articulate technical concepts to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Proven experience in a technical project or product management, preferably at a SaaS company.
  • Experience developing a Public API or developer focused product would be useful but not essential. 
  • Passion for technology and keeping a close eye on emerging trends.
